    If you are still at General Draw Quality 10 then that is why.

    General Draw Quality sets the buffer used for frame rendering, and at 8 it is equal to your resolution, at 9 it is 1.5 times your resolution and at 10 it is twice your resolution.

    So, when you were playing at 2560x1440 the game was actually rendering the frames in a 5120x2880 buffer.
